| Definition:
Planet Earth is the only celestial body with known living organisms. |
|
Structure:
The earth is the only known planet with the proper mixture of geological
and atmospheric environments, or ecosystems, to support life. ItÕs
distance from the sun allows an environment with gravity that is compatible
with life, and temperature and water compatible for sustaining the many
populations of organisms that live on the planet earth. As one of their
activities, scientists, begining with Aristotle, have organized their findings
to reach a common language, or vocabulary. They decided that the best major
divisions of science were of physical sciences, earth sciences, aeronautical
and space sciences, and biological sciences.
Function:
Planet Earth provides a home for biological organisms through its' geological,
and atmospheric environments.
